We are staying at CSR the day before our cruise on halloween. we need to trick or treat with our 2 kids that night. Any ideas? I heard DTD or BW or Camp ground and camp fire or haunted hayride. Is there any thread or place to be directed to that would have activities listed and times etc.? anyone done something last year or previous years you could share? The Halloween party is too late at MK and I think it is sold out.
 
now that I'm back, I will answere my own question. It was great! In 2004 we went to MNSSHP and the kids were disappointed in the sour balls and little rubber spider rings and sweet tarts. Some choc bars but not many and all were small. We are hesitant to do the Party again after this. I as the mom loved the party and the mk and all the shows, but kids are kids and they associate halloween with treats. Maybe there is better candy now at MNSSHP???

This year we were at csr. they had halloween pinata's at the beach full of candy. lots and lots of candy. In the afternoon around 1 or 2 they started breaking pinata's. They must have had about 4, bats and ghosts. My son broke a purple bat and carried this thing with us for the next 5 days thru, 3 day dcl and back home on the plane. It is now in his room hanging on his wall. I did not encourage this but he loved the thing as he broke it. My kids rec'd some candy there at the pool. We had planned to go dtd to trick or treat in our costumes but they had something at csr. They had cap hook and smee posing with the kids, lots of stations for candy and crafts. My kids were given generous amounts of candy from these tables, choc bars, nerds, skittles, lots of choc pumpkins and monsters, candy corns. they gave each kid fist fulls of candy. We then were dissapointed at dtd. they had a magician and dj but it was so crowded. the lines in and out of the stores were long and then they only gave out a taffy on a stick or dum dum or small now and later. No fist fulls of candy. I suppose it is realevent due to the crowds. csr had a such a small crowd of kids that I wonder if they would have had such generous portions of candy at say the POP where I am sure there were larger amounts of kids.

We left dtd and went to boardwalk. They had pumpkin donald and farmer mickey to pose for pictures. They had boardwalk entertainment such as magicians, jugglers etc. they had scavenger hunt and dj. Also had tables to get candy and crafts, cookie decorating. the candy was not as generous as CSR.

All in all Halloween candy was just as large a loot as if we had stayed home which made the kids happy.
